Ameresco and Atura Power JV Selected to Build 250MW/1,000MWh Battery Energy Storage System
Portfolio Pulse from Benzinga Newsdesk
Ameresco (NYSE:AMRC) and Atura Power, a subsidiary of Ontario Power Generation, have been selected by the Independent Electricity System Operator (IESO) in Canada to build a 250MW/1,000MWh battery energy storage system (BESS) through their joint venture, Napanee BESS Inc. The JV will enter into a twenty-year capacity agreement with the IESO.
